HV Construction Manager

Location: Norfolk (Accommodation Provided) Contract: 18 Months IR35 Status: Outside IR35 Rate: Excellent Day Rate (DOE)

We are seeking an experienced HV Construction Manager to join a landmark renewable energy project in Norfolk. You'll play a key role in the delivery of a major HVDC Converter Station as part of one of the UK’s largest offshore wind developments.

This is an excellent opportunity to work on a high-profile infrastructure project with a long-term contract, competitive rates, and accommodation provided.

Key Responsibilities

  • Manage the safe delivery of HV construction works on site.
  • Coordinate subcontractors and construction activities to programme.
  • Ensure compliance with health, safety, environmental and quality standards.
  • Oversee installation, testing and commissioning activities in collaboration with engineering and commissioning teams.
  • Monitor project progress, resolve site issues and report on performance.
  • Liaise with the client, principal contractor and wider project stakeholders.
